First, what is a red phone?

The red phone is a highly confidential communication phone, that originated in the Cold War period, and belongs to the communication hotline between the Kremlin and the White House, the two sides through the secret communication hotline to do rapid communication, to avoid the two countries into a nuclear war.

In the multi-polar world after the end of the Cold War, the U.S. and Russia still have a red phone to do secret communication, both sides do not want the earth to fall into a nuclear war. This communication is timely and effective for the U.S. and Russia.
